  • Electrical switching devices are essential components of an electrical supply network. Electrical switching devices in the context of the present invention are switching devices for high voltage applications with more than 1 kV voltage.
  • a plurality of interrupter units are activated one after the other due to the high switched voltages in an electrical switching device. assigns.
  • uneven voltage distributions arise between the individual interrupter units and between the interrupter units against the electrical earth, which can result in part in the destruction of the voltage-loaded interrupter unit and thus of the electrical switching device.
  • control capacitors are connected in parallel with the electrical switch point of each interrupter unit, which serve to form an almost uniformly distributed voltage across the electrical switching device.
  • the individual interrupter units of the electrical switching device are subjected to almost equal stress in terms of voltage.
  • These control capacitors lead to an almost complete galvanic isolation of the individual breaker units in the switched-off state with an applied AC voltage and are therefore used as standard in high-voltage circuit breakers.
  • control capacitors in electrical Weggeraten represents a significant cost factor.
  • the additional control capacitors within the interrupter units generate mechanical loads that can lead to the destruction of the electrical Weggerats especially when strong vibrations occur as in a quake or a storm.
  • harmful resonances of the voltage amplitudes within the electrical Weggerats or even within the entire electrical supply network arise.
  • the document DE 199 58 646 C2 discloses a hybrid power switch with a vacuum switching chamber designed as a selector chamber with a conductive coating. A second switching chamber provided contains no conductive coating.
  • the working range of the electrical resistance of the hybrid power switch generated by the conductive coating is less than 500 k ⁇ .
  • Object of the present invention is therefore to avoid the above-mentioned disadvantages in the prior art and to provide an electrical switching device at your disposal, which is inexpensive to manufacture.

  • the interrupter unit is a switching chamber with a switch point, wherein the Sehaltkarmmer has a weakly conductive coating.
  • This coating acts as an electrical resistance, which is arranged parallel to the arranged inside the switching chamber electrical switch point.
  • the conductive coating is attached to the inner walls of the switching chamber.
  • the conductive coating contains conductive paints, conductive plastics, such as: B. filled with Leitfahtechniksruß plastics or intrinsically conductive plastics, such. B. doped polyacetylene or Polypyrrpol.
  • the conductive coating may contain conductive glazes, such as. B. Glazes with SnO / Sb x O y additives.
  • the conductive coating is advantageously applied from the inside to the inner walls of the switching chamber, in particular brushed and / or sprayed on and / or applied by a dipping process.
  • an insulating duster is used for holding at least one interrupter unit, wherein the duster is also coated from the inside with a conductive coating.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un commutateur électrique avec commande de potentiel, comprenant au moins une unité de sectionnement, l'unité de sectionnement présentant un point de commutation électrique et l'unité de sectionnement à chaque fois munie d'un point de commutation possédant une capacité électrique par rapport à la terre électrique. Les commutateurs électriques tels que les commutateurs de puissance pour les équipements à haute tension, par exemple, sont généralement utilisés avec des condensateurs dits de commande branchés en parallèle avec le point de commutation pour l'homogénéisation de la tension sur plusieurs unités de sectionnement d'un commutateur électrique, ce qui permet de garantir une contrainte de tension quasiment homogène pour toutes les unités de sectionnement du commutateur électrique. L'objet de la présente invention est d'utiliser, en remplacement ou en complément des condensateurs de commande utilisés, des composants à action résistive et/ou inductive pour l'homogénéisation de la tension sur un commutateur électrique.
